Ask financial questions in plain English—then get exact results from Google Sheets/CSV using PostgreSQL + an AI SQL agent
This n8n workflow lets you query structured financial data from Google Sheets or CSV files by converting natural-language questions into SQL with an AI agent. Instead of relying on vector databases (which often struggle with numerical accuracy), it uses PostgreSQL for efficient storage and fast, precise numeric querying.
What this workflow does
- Retrieves your data from a Google Sheet (via a public/shared URL) or from CSV.
- Infers the data schema and creates a corresponding PostgreSQL table.
- Populates PostgreSQL with your sheet/CSV records.
- Uses an AI agent to translate your natural-language question into optimized SQL.
- Executes the SQL in PostgreSQL and returns precise numerical results quickly.
Use cases
- Finance and ops reporting: “What were total expenses by category last month?”
- Sheet-to-database querying: Turn a structured Google Sheet into a queryable PostgreSQL dataset.
- Non-SQL teams: Let SaaS operators and automation engineers generate correct SQL without writing it manually.
- Cost-effective analytics: Avoid vector-database inefficiencies while keeping queries performant as data grows.
Technical details
- AI-generated SQL driven by an agent to create queries from natural language.
- Database: PostgreSQL (standard installation; no special extensions required).
